Erica O’Brien, the visionary behind The Rose Establishment, is transforming the dim, mysterious corner of Pierpont Ave and 400 West with Night Rose—a monthly dinner series brimming with life, flavor, and an irresistible dose of vibey allure. Designed to nourish both body and soul, these evenings promise an intoxicating blend of elevated dining and magnetic ambiance, where the shadows come alive with sultry, spirited energy.

Night Rose is a celebration of collaboration—a space where we come together with the talented friends and industry peers we deeply admire to craft thoughtfully curated food and drinks, for the community we cherish and aspire to grow.

This intimate, beautifully restored venue traces its roots back to the early 1900s, when it served as an open garage with a loading dock floor plan. Over the decades, it has undergone many transformations, including its cherished era as Pallet Bistro, brought to life in 2012 by the talented Cody Derrick (cityhomeCOLLECTIVE).

Though Pallet now rests in peace, Cody’s inspired designs live on—by day, for weekend brunch at The Rose Establishment, and by night, in one memorable experience each month: Night Rose.

Join us for our first-ever Night Rose dinner, featuring the culinary artistry of Chef Evan Francois (Saltd) and the expert pairings of Educator Francis Fecteau (Libation SLC). Together, we’ll ring in 2025 with a seasonally inspired prix fixe menu, thoughtfully paired beverages, and equally exceptional non-alcoholic and vegetarian options.
